Institutional investors’ mixed activity—ranging from increased stakes by Raub Brock Capital Management to reduced holdings by Voya—indicates diverging views on Zoetis’ valuation and growth potential.
Zoetis faces headwinds from declining veterinary visits and competitive pressures in key markets, such as dermatology. However, management highlighted a robust innovation pipeline, . Zoetis’ recent performance reflects a balance of optimism and caution. Strong institutional ownership and a dividend increase signal confidence in its fundamentals, while earnings outperformance and innovation efforts highlight long-term potential. However, revenue shortfalls, mixed analyst ratings, and strategic challenges underscore the need for careful evaluation. The stock’s trajectory will likely depend on its ability to navigate these pressures and deliver on its innovation roadmap.
